Instant Pot® Shrimp Broth

Don't throw out those shrimp shells! Use them to make a rich homemade shrimp broth for that next batch of jambalaya, etouffee, or other seafood stews.

Preparation Time
5 mins
Cooking Time
1 hr 10 mins
Total Time
1 hr 15 mins
Calories
19 Calories

Recipe Instructions

Step 1
Combine shrimp shells, baby carrots, onion, celery, garlic, vinegar, salt, pepper, and water in a multi-functional pressure cooker (such as Instant Pot®). Close and lock the lid. Select Manual function according to manufacturer's instructions; set timer for 60 minutes. Allow 10 minutes for pressure to build.
Step 2
Release pressure using the natural-release method according to manufacturer's instructions, about 10 minutes. Release remaining pressure carefully using the quick-release method according to manufacturer's instructions, about 5 minutes. Unlock and remove the lid. Pour liquid through a strainer and discard all solids.
Instant Pot® Shrimp Broth

Ingredients

  • 1 tablespoon distilled white vinegar
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1 teaspoon ground black pepper
  • 5 cups water
  • 2 cloves garlic, halved
  • 10 baby carrots
  • 4 cups shrimp shells from 2 pounds of shrimp
  • 1 onion, halved and root end removed
  • 1 stalk celery, cut into thirds
